Yakov Danilovich Mintchenkov (1878-1938)-a native of the Lugansk Cossacks, a student of N. A. Kasatkin and V. A. Serov. Active participant in the partnership of mobile art exhibitions, painter, sculptor and teacher. Unfortunately, most of his works died during the Great Patriotic War, but we remained his memories of the Wanderers, first published back in 1940 and were very popular for many years. Live, bright, very emotional, portrait and psychologically multifaceted stories of Mintchenkov about their colleagues, famous and not very, Russian artists, are hardly indifferent to any reader.
